Unlike traditional horizontal axis turbines, vertical axis designs offer several advantages that make them ideal for both urban and rural settings. Their ability to harness wind from any direction means they are less sensitive to changes in wind patterns, ensuring consistent energy production. Moreover, the compact size and lower height profile of vertical axis turbines allow for easier installation and maintenance, paving the way for widespread adoption. This is particularly advantageous in urban areas where space is limited. With their durable design and minimal noise, these turbines can seamlessly blend into various environments, providing clean energy without disrupting local communities.
